Abstract

The invention discloses a fireproof door. The fireproof door comprises a rectangle metal casing provided with a discharging port in front and is characterized by further comprising a top plate, a base plate, a fire-resisting plate, a material box and sealing plugs, wherein the top plate and the base plate are arranged at the top end and the bottom end of the metal casing, and the fire-resisting plate, the material box and the sealing plugs are arranged between the top plate and the base plate from back to front. The material box is provided with a box port in butted joint with the discharging port, a dry powder extinguishing agent is filled inside the material box, and an encapsulation film is arranged at the position of the box opening. The sealing plugs are plugged into the box port and the discharging port. The fireproof door has the advantages of improving the fireproof performance, having a certain fire extinguishing function, prolonging fire propagation time and increasing time for people escape.

Description

technical field [0001] The invention relates to a fireproof building material, in particular to a fireproof door with fireproof and fire extinguishing functions. Background technique [0002] Generally, fire doors are widely used in many fields such as residential houses, ships, buildings, chemicals, and mechanical engineering. Fire doors refer to doors with fire-resistant properties, which buy time for people to escape from the fire in the event of a fire, prevent the spread of fire, delay the spread of fire, and be fire-resistant for a certain period of time. Therefore, fire doors play a vital role in the event of a fire. The fire performance of metal doors is one of the concerns of people. The existing metal door has single function and poor fire performance. Contents of the invention [0003] In order to solve the deficiencies of the prior art, the object of the present invention is to provide a fire door capable of preventing and extinguishing fire.
